** The Nissan repair market for Turtlepoint, PA, and its immediate surrounding area (McKean County) is characterized by a reliance on skilled independent repair shops rather than brand-specific dealerships or dedicated performance centers. There are no Nissan dealerships or shops explicitly advertising GT-R or hybrid system specialization within a 30-mile radius. The market is not highly competitive in terms of volume, but the established shops maintain strong reputations for quality and reliability, as they serve a widespread rural community. The average quality of service is good for general maintenance and common repairs (VQ engines, CVTs). However, for highly specialized work on performance vehicles like the GT-R or complex hybrid systems, owners would likely need to travel to a major metropolitan area such as Erie or Buffalo. Pricing is generally below national dealership averages, reflecting the local cost of living, but labor rates for complex diagnostics and transmission work are in line with regional standards. Given Turtlepoint's rural roads and harsh winter weather, we frequently address CVT transmission concerns, premature brake wear from dirt and gravel roads, and rust-related issues on frames and exhaust components. Regular undercarriage washes in winter and transmission fluid checks are highly recommended to combat these local factors.
